Understanding Game Mechanics & Afk Spin Compatibility

Not all mobile games lend themselves equally to an afk spin strategy. The effectiveness of the technique hinges heavily on the underlying game mechanics. Games with resource accumulation systems that continue to function passively, even when the application is minimized or the device is locked, are prime candidates. Titles that reward players for time spent logged in, rather than active interaction, also prove suitable. Conversely, games requiring constant, precise input or featuring anti-afk measures will likely render the strategy ineffective. Examining the game’s reward structure is critical. Does the game provide consistent, predictable rewards even when not actively played? If so, an afk spin setup is worth exploring. Consider the frequency of resource generation, the duration of available bonuses, and the potential impact of inactivity on reward rates.

Furthermore, understanding a game’s detection methods is vital. Many games implement systems to identify and penalize players suspected of using automated tools or exploiting afk behaviors. These systems can range from simple inactivity timers to sophisticated algorithms that analyze player patterns. Bypassing these detection mechanisms, if possible, often involves mimicking natural user behavior through randomized input or utilizing specialized software designed to maintain a persistent connection. However, it is important to acknowledge that this can potentially breach the terms of service, leading to account suspension or termination. Careful research into the game’s community and forums can reveal insights into the effectiveness of various afk spin methods and the associated risks.

Optimizing In-Game Settings for Afk Play

Before attempting an afk spin, thoroughly review the game's settings menu. Adjusting graphical settings to the lowest possible level can significantly reduce battery consumption and minimize device heating, prolonging the duration of uninterrupted play. Disabling unnecessary animations and visual effects can further contribute to energy savings. Sound settings should also be adjusted; muting the game or reducing the volume can slightly decrease power drain. Many games also offer options to automatically collect rewards or complete simple tasks. Enabling these features can maximize the efficiency of the afk spin, ensuring that valuable resources are not missed. Exploring options regarding notifications is also helpful. Turning off push notifications can help to avoid involuntary interactions that break the afk state.

Additionally, some games allow players to customize their auto-save frequency. Increasing the auto-save interval can reduce the processing load on the device, further conserving battery life. However, be mindful of the potential risk of data loss if the game crashes unexpectedly. Regularly monitoring the game's performance during afk sessions is crucial. Pay attention to battery usage, device temperature, and any error messages that may appear. If the device overheats or the game becomes unstable, it's best to discontinue the afk spin to prevent potential damage or data loss.

Battery Management & Device Considerations

Running a game in afk mode for extended periods significantly strains the device's battery. Implementing effective battery management strategies is therefore crucial. Closing all unnecessary background applications can free up processing power and reduce energy consumption. Lowering the screen brightness or enabling dark mode can also contribute to significant battery savings. Consider utilizing battery-saving mode, although this may slightly impact game performance. Moreover, ensuring the device remains adequately cooled during afk sessions is essential to prevent overheating and battery degradation. Overheating can not only damage the device but also trigger throttling, reducing game performance and potentially interrupting the afk spin. Utilizing a phone cooler or placing the device in a well-ventilated area can help mitigate this risk.

The type of device also plays a role in afk spin performance. Devices with larger batteries and more efficient processors are better equipped to handle prolonged gaming sessions. Older devices or those with limited battery capacity may struggle to maintain a stable afk spin for extended periods. Optimizing the charging routine is also important. Avoid fully charging or fully discharging the battery, as this can contribute to long-term battery degradation. Instead, aim to keep the battery level between 20% and 80%. Monitoring the device's temperature and battery usage throughout the afk spin is essential. If the device becomes excessively hot or the battery drains rapidly, it's best to pause the session to prevent potential damage.

Potential Risks and Ethical Considerations

While the afk spin technique offers numerous benefits, it's essential to acknowledge the potential risks and ethical implications. Many game developers explicitly prohibit the use of automated tools or methods that circumvent intended gameplay mechanics. Violating these terms of service can result in account suspension or permanent ban. Furthermore, some players view afk spinning as unfair or exploitative, arguing that it gives an undue advantage to those who are willing to circumvent the game's intended design. This can create a negative environment within the game community and diminish the overall gaming experience for others. Consider the potential impact on the game's economy and balance when deciding whether to employ an afk spin strategy. If the technique significantly disrupts the game's ecosystem, it may be ethically questionable.

It’s also important to be aware of the security risks associated with utilizing third-party tools or software. Downloading applications from untrusted sources can expose the device to malware or viruses. Protecting personal information and account credentials is paramount. Carefully vetting any software before installation and utilizing a reputable antivirus program can help mitigate these risks. Finally, be mindful of the potential for addiction and excessive gaming. The convenience of afk spinning can lead to increased playtime and a blurring of the lines between leisure and compulsion. Maintaining a healthy balance between gaming and other aspects of life is crucial.
